Desktop Metal Inc
Desktop Metal Inc. is a leading metal 3D printing company, founded in 2015 by Ric Fulop and Jonah Myerberg, with headquarters in Burlington, Massachusetts. The goal of Desktop Metal is to provide cost-effective and accessible metal 3D printing systems for manufacturers, engineers, and designers worldwide.

Desktop Metal offers two main metal 3D printing solutions for the market, the Studio System and the Production System. The Studio System is designed to produce metal parts in-house, it uses a three-part process: printing metal parts using FDM technology, debinding the parts, and sintering them. The Production System is an industrial 3D printer designed for high-throughput metal 3D printing for large-scale manufacturing uses, it uses a new technology known as Single Pass Jetting (SPJ).

Desktop Metal's studio system focuses mainly on the production of complex metal parts such as jigs, fixtures, and tooling. The Production System, on the other hand, is designed for the scalable production of end-use metal parts. The SPJ technology used by Production System builds parts in a layerless and continuous process that creates 3D printed isotropic parts with excellent mechanical properties.

Desktop Metal Inc. is one of the fastest-growing 3D printing companies in the world, with a team of more than 400 employees who work to develop, market, and support their 3D printing solutions worldwide. The company has already attracted over $450 million in funding, with notable investors such as Ford, BMW, and Google Ventures.

In conclusion, Desktop Metal Inc. is a leading company in the metal 3D printing industry, offering cost-effective and accessible solutions for in-house production of metal parts. They are continuously developing new technologies to advance the 3D printing industry and expand the application base for metal 3D printing.

Desktop Metal Inc. Shocks Market with Unexpected Revenue Contraction in Q3 2024!

Desktop Metal Inc: A Year in Review and Future Prospects Performance OverviewOver the past twelve months, Desktop Metal Inc has faced significant challenges, with its shares plummeting by 45.36%. This stark decline starkly contrasts with the broader market's performance, which saw an impressive increase of 40.39% during the same period. Such a disparity raises questions about the underlying factors driving Desktop Metal's underperformance and the company's path forward. Financial Results in Q3 2024In the fiscal third quarter of 2024, Desktop Metal Inc reported a loss per share of $-1.07, an improvement from $-1.40 in the same quarter last year. Despite this reduction in loss, the company experienced a notable decline in revenue, which fell by 13.75% to $36.16 million from $41.92 million in Q3 2023. This is worrisome, especially considering the broader Industrial Machinery and Components sector, which posted a revenue increase of 5.37% during the same period.

Desktop Metal Inc Faces Profit Shortfall of $-0.16 per Share in Q1 2024

Investors in Desktop Metal Inc (NYSE: DM) have been closely following the company's financial performance in the first quarter of 2024. The company recently reported a net loss of $-0.16 per share, compared to a loss of $-0.16 per share in the same period last year. Despite this loss, there was an improvement in Income per Share, which increased from $-0.53 per share in the previous financial reporting period.
Revenue for Desktop Metal Inc contracted by -3.684% to $39.79 million in the first quarter of 2024, compared to $41.32 million in the same period last year. Sequentially, revenue fell by -24.319% from $52.58 million. This decline in revenue is in contrast to the on average rise seen in the Industrial Machinery and Components sector during the same period.
